Before we tell you how you can include aloe vera gel in your beauty regimen this summer, it’s important for you to know how to extract it. Sure, aloe vera gel can be found in stores, but store-bought aloe vera gel isn’t completely organic. For the best results, pure, organic aloe vera gel is your best bet. Here’s how you can acquire it:

- Break a leaf from an aloe plant.
- Grab a knife and cut the leaf open.
- Squeeze the leaf and let the gel drip into a bowl.
Yes, it’s that simple! However, you need to make sure you don’t store the gel for too long, as, in order to reap all its benefits, it’s best to use it when it’s fresh.
Now that you know how to acquire aloe vera gel, here’s how you can incorporate it into your beauty routine this summer:
- Use it as a moisturizer
When it’s extremely hot and humid outside, the last thing you want is a greasy moisturizer. Aloe vera gel can serve as a lightweight moisturizer that nourishes your skin and keeps it hydrated. It’s your best bet if you’re looking to keep things natural. Furthermore, aloe vera gel is able to absorb quickly into your skin, but is strong enough to smooth over every dry patch. - It’s a great after-sun gel
Only a couple of minutes in the sun can do an unimaginable amount of damage to your skin. You could use aloe vera gel wherever your skin is red or sunburnt. Thanks to aloe vera gel’s great anti-inflammatory properties, this gel will soothe any sort of discomfort your skin is suffering from due to the sun, and will replenish it. In addition to this, aloe vera gel can also prevent your skin from peeling. - Use it as a shaving gel
Summer’s the time for cute sundresses and shorts, which means you’ll probably have to shave your legs quite often. Shaving can really irritate your skin, and can also result in cuts if you aren’t careful. Apply aloe vera gel post-shave to soothe your skin and lock in moisture, so that you’re left skin that’s soft and smooth. - Use it as a hair mask
Lazing on a beautiful beach is great, but do you do enough to keep your hair from becoming dehydrated? Just like your skin, your hair also loses all its moisture due to heat. To keep your hair nourished, you could apply aloe vera gel to your hair about once a week. It’ll keep your scalp clean, moisturize your locks, as well as promote healthy hair growth.
